Pakistan Navy finds wreckage of cargo plane

PM Shehbaz expresses sorrow over tragic incident in which “cargo aircraft crashed into Arabian sea and went missing” Nazir Siyal KARACHI: The Pakistan Navy and Pakistan Maritime Security Agency (PMSA) are conducting a joint search operation to locate a missing private cargo aircraft. During the operation, which has been ongoing for more than 12 hours at sea, the wreckage of the aircraft was discovered approximately 53 nautical miles south of Ormara’s coast. FPCCI launches “Home to Hub” initiative to propel women entrepreneurs toward exports

KARACHI, JUL 8 /DNA/ – Atif Ikram Sheikh, President of the Federation of Pakistan Chambers of Commerce & Industry (FPCCI), hosted the inaugural “Home to Hub Initiative” today at FPCCI Head Office, Federation House, Karachi. Mr. Atif Ikram Sheikh apprised that the milestone event marks the formal beginning of a structured journey designed to transform Pakistan’s women entrepreneurs from home-based beginners to export-ready business leaders.
